Rambler's Top100
Форум: MS ACCESSVBVBA MS OfficeMS SQL server
Новые сообщения: 0000

Форум: MS ACCESS

Вопросы связанные с MS ACCESS

Обновить визитку
Участники «Online»
Все участники

 
 

Доброго времени суток,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: програмно "сжать" (zip или rar) Excel-файл, который создан с помощью макроса?
 
 автор: lurix   (22.04.2009 в 15:14)   личное сообщение
 
 

подскажите, как можно програмно "сжать" (zip или rar) Excel-файл, который создан с помощью макроса?

  Ответить  
 
 автор: Кабан   (22.04.2009 в 16:13)   личное сообщение
 
 

http://hiprog.com/index.php?option=com_content&task=view&id=251661619&Itemid=35

  Ответить  
 
 автор: lurix   (22.04.2009 в 16:39)   личное сообщение
 
 

рассмотрела данный пример, спасибо!
а как его в rar переделать?...

  Ответить  
 
 автор: Кабан   (22.04.2009 в 16:59)   личное сообщение
 
 

архивация RARом через CreateProcess
http://hiprog.com/index.php?option=com_content&task=view&id=326&Itemid=35

  Ответить  
 
 автор: lurix   (23.04.2009 в 16:24)   личное сообщение
 
 

пока разбираюсь....спасибо!

  Ответить  
 
 автор: lurix   (24.04.2009 в 11:35)   личное сообщение
 
 

не получилось разобраться...
уже попробовала из zip сделать rar - ошибки...
скиньте пожалуйста пример

  Ответить  
 
 автор: Кабан   (24.04.2009 в 11:51)   личное сообщение
 
 

какой еще пример скинуть?
там все написано! обрабатывайте ошибки, разбирайтесь

  Ответить  
 
 автор: lurix   (24.04.2009 в 12:01)   личное сообщение
 
 

- выдает ошибку "Overflow"
не находит процедуру/функцию WaitForSingleObject
подскажите, как это исправить

  Ответить  
 
 автор: Дрюня   (24.04.2009 в 12:04)   личное сообщение
 
 

если есть интерес, могу скинуть пример на VB, где используется ZIP архивирование
("мопед не мой, я просто объявление разместил...")

  Ответить  
 
 автор: lurix   (24.04.2009 в 12:07)   личное сообщение
 
 

благодарю, но с zipом я разобралась, получилось!
но файл оказался большим, rar сжал максимально - в 4 раза меньше, чем zip...((((((
продолжаю ковыряться....

  Ответить  
 
 автор: Дрюня   (24.04.2009 в 13:16)   личное сообщение
 
 

зато ЗИП безвозмездный и можно распространять

  Ответить  
 
 автор: lurix   (24.04.2009 в 13:27)   личное сообщение
 
 

цель - файлы минимального размера.
потому zip не подойдет...

  Ответить  
 
 автор: Кабан   (24.04.2009 в 13:27)   личное сообщение
 
 

>>не находит процедуру/функцию WaitForSingleObject
тю. обычная APIшная функция из ядра Windows
она может не находиться только если вы неправильно её объявили.
например:
надеюсь вы все скопировали в модуль VBA, а не в модуль формы? ;)
или вы работаете под Linux

з.ы. вот еще какаиято тема про архивирование раром
http://hiprog.com/forum/read.php?id_forum=1&id_theme=1422&page=1

  Ответить  
 
 автор: lurix   (24.04.2009 в 17:58)   личное сообщение
 
 

именно все - в модуль VBA скопировала!

  Ответить  
 
 автор: Кабан   (24.04.2009 в 18:25)   личное сообщение
 
 

тогда странно. может у вас Vista? может там что поменялось в API?

  Ответить  
 
 автор: lurix   (27.04.2009 в 10:33)   личное сообщение
 
 

Windows 2003....
не знаю, что произошло за выходные, но теперь выдает только "Overflow" и на этом процесс заканчивается...
"

  Ответить  
 
 автор: lurix   (27.04.2009 в 10:28)   личное сообщение
 
 

благодаря Вашей ссылке заинтересовал вариант следующий:
1)создала батник
3)на клик кнопки повесила выполнение батника ... через SHELL

  Ответить  
 
 автор: lurix   (27.04.2009 в 14:22)   личное сообщение
 
 

НО! непосредственно запуская батник ручками - все отлично, а если через shell - только Updating...
в чем проблема???

  Ответить  
 
 автор: Дрюня   (22.04.2009 в 16:18)   личное сообщение
 
 

еще здесь стоит посмотреть
http://www.info-zip.org/

  Ответить  
HiProg.com - Технологии программирования
Rambler's Top100 TopList